The world's oldest refugee agency, HIAS, is facing funding cuts under the Trump administration's budget slashing, resulting in layoffs and a significant impact on the refugee aid system. HIAS President Mark Hetfield warns that the consequences will be felt within the Jewish community and in interfaith relations.
